Yeah, there are loads and loads of things to upgrade. The game is designed so you can't max everything out, even when you've hit max level (unless you use a trainer or something to get yourself extra points). This is good, IMO, as it means that your individual playing style has an incredible amount of impact on the way your character develops.
Your level is the number of little sphere's lit up in the row at the top. At level 10, it goes empty again.
